Output 31082516ed1931c86454f262abeb2b6ae59a9a6d2db31d04f7f12ec43bb0fa2f:8

value
32463780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0456b238dbda68040f4b7eec07450f7ee36898ec OP_EQUAL
address
M8J6nxGXCzqmyJVCncvMeLEKPTKN5443uB
transaction
31082516ed1931c86454f262abeb2b6ae59a9a6d2db31d04f7f12ec43bb0fa2f
spent
true